Several body functions deteriorate with age. The external signs of aging are easily identifiable. For example, the skin becomes dry, less elastic, and thins out, forming wrinkles. The skin of the face begins to appear looser due to a decrease in the levels of elastic and collagen fibers in the connective tissue. The color of the skin is influenced by a number of pigments, including melanin, carotene, and hemoglobin. Recall that melanin is produced by cells called melanocytes, which are found scattered throughout the stratum basale of the epidermis. The melanin is transferred to the keratinocytes via melanosomes.

Menopause, a natural biological process marking the end of a woman's fertility, typically occurs between the fifth and sixth decade of life. This phase is characterized by the exhaustion of the ovarian follicle pool, leading to less responsive ovaries despite the high levels of Follicle Stimulating Hormone (FSH) and Luteinizing Hormone (LH). 背景情况:

  • 老龄化显著影响皮肤健康,估计70%的老年人面临皮肤问题.
  • 在识别和解决老年人的特定护肤需求方面存在着显著的差距.
  • 医疗保健专业人员往往缺乏针对老年皮肤病的适当培训和计划服务.

研究的目的:

  • 强调专业护肤对老龄化人口的关键重要性.
  • 提高护士对与衰老相关的生理性皮肤变化的理解.
  • 倡导改善老年皮肤健康的护理标准.

主要方法:

  • 文献综述侧重于与年龄相关的皮肤变化.
  • 对老年人皮肤疾病报告的分析.
  • 为医疗保健专业人员开发教育内容.

主要成果:

  • 确定了老年人皮肤问题的广泛流行.
  • 突出了患者自我意识和关于老年皮肤病的专业培训的缺陷.
  • 强调需要对老年人的皮肤提供结构化的医疗保健服务.

结论:

  • 积极主动和知情的护肤对于保持老年人的健康至关重要.
  • 加强护士的教育对于解决老龄化人口独特的皮肤病需求至关重要.
  • 改善服务规划是必要的,以有效地支持老年人的皮肤健康.
